View file sots-syet-livebook/user/roller/index.php

File size: 4.53Kb
<?
include_once $_SERVER['DOCUMENT_ROOT'].'/sys/inc/home.php';
include_once H.'sys/inc/start.php';
include_once H.'sys/inc/compress.php';
include_once H.'sys/inc/sess.php';
include_once H.'sys/inc/settings.php';
include_once H.'sys/inc/db_connect.php';
include_once H.'sys/inc/ipua.php';
include_once H.'sys/inc/fnc.php';
include_once H.'sys/inc/user.php';
only_reg();

if ($set['roller_status'] == 0 || !isset($roller)) {
	header('Location: /index.php');
	exit;
}

if (isset($_GET['roller']) && $roller['time'] < $time && $set['roller_days'] >= $roller['days']) {
	mysql_query("UPDATE `roller` SET `time` = '" . ($ftime + $roller_num) . "', `days` = `days` + '1' WHERE `id_user` = '$user[id]' LIMIT 1");
	
	if ($roller['days'] + 1 > $set['roller_days']){
		
		mysql_query("UPDATE `user` SET `balls` = `balls` + '" . $set['roller_balls'] . "', `money` = `money` + '" . $set['roller_money'] . "', `rating` = `rating` + '" . $set['roller_rating'] . "' WHERE `id` = '$user[id]' LIMIT 1");
		
		// Сообщение о выплатах
		$msg = 'Уважаемый [b]' . user::nick($user['id'], 0) . '[/b] вы отмечались [b]' . $set['roller_days'] . ' дн' . ($set['roller_days'] == 3 ? 'я' : 'ей') . '[/b] подряд, и в награду получаете ' . ($set['roller_balls'] > 0 ? ' [blue]' . $set['roller_balls'] . ' баллов[/blue] ' : '') .
	($set['roller_money'] > 0 ? ' [red]' . $set['roller_money'] . ' ' . $sMonet[0] . '[/red] ' : '') .
	($set['roller_rating'] > 0 ? ' [green]' . $set['roller_rating'] . '% рейтинга[/green] ' : '') . '. :) ';
		
		// Отправляем
		mysql_query("INSERT INTO `mail` (`id_user`, `id_kont`, `msg`, `time`) values('0', '$user[id]', '".my_esc($msg)."', '$time')");
		
	}
	
	$_SESSION['message'] = __('Перекличка прошла успешно');
	header('Location: ?');
	exit;
}
	
$set['title'] = __('Перекличка');
include_once H.'sys/inc/thead.php';

title();
aut();

?>

<style>
a.roller {
	padding: 3px;
	margin: 1px;
	background-color: #31b300;
	border: 1px solid #1c6204;
	border-radius: 5px;
	-moz-border-radius: 5px;
	color:#ffffff;
	
}
</style>

<div class="main">
<b><?= user::nick($user['id'], 0)?></b>, 
заходи на сайт <b><?= $set['roller_days']?> дн<?= ($set['roller_days'] == 3 ? 'я' : 'ей')?></b> подряд, 
тебе будет открываться эта страничка, жми на кнопку "Отметится", отметившись у каждого дня, ты получиш вознаграждение.
</div>

<?
for ($i = 1; $set['roller_days'] >= $i; $i++) {
	?>
	<a class="link" href="?roller">
	<img width="20" src="_images/<?= ($roller['days'] > $i ? $i : 0)?>.png"> 
	
	<b style="<?= ($roller['days'] > $i ? 'color: green;' : 'color: gray;')?>"><?= $i?> день</b> 
	
	<?= ($roller['days'] > $i ? '<span class="on"> <b>&radic;</b> Готово</span>' : '')?>
	
	<?= ($roller['days'] < $i ? '<span class="off"> <b>&times;</b> в ожидании...</span> ' : '')?>
	
	<?= ($roller['days'] == $i && $roller['time'] > $time ? '<span style="color: blue;"> <b>&sim;</b> отметка завтра..</span> ' : '')?>
	
	<?= ($roller['days'] == $i && $roller['time'] < $time ? ' Отметится ' : '')?></a>
	<?
}
?>
<div class="gmenu">
<?
if ($set['roller_days'] >= $roller['days']) {
	echo 'Вознаграждение по окончании переклички:<br />' 
	. ($set['roller_balls'] > 0 ? ' [<b style="color: blue;">' . $set['roller_balls'] . ' баллов</b>] ' : '') .
	($set['roller_money'] > 0 ? ' [<b style="color: red;">' . $set['roller_money'] . ' ' . $sMonet[0] . '</b>] ' : '') .
	($set['roller_rating'] > 0 ? ' [<b style="color: green;">' . $set['roller_rating'] . '% рейтинга</b>] ' : '');
} elseif ($set['roller_days'] < $roller['days']) {
	echo 'Вы успешно закончили перекличку, и получили ' 
	. ($set['roller_balls'] > 0 ? ' [<b style="color: blue;">' . $set['roller_balls'] . ' баллов</b>] ' : '') .
	($set['roller_money'] > 0 ? ' [<b style="color: red;">' . $set['roller_money'] . ' ' . $sMonet[0] . '</b>] ' : '') .
	($set['roller_rating'] > 0 ? ' [<b style="color: green;">' . $set['roller_rating'] . '% рейтинга</b>] ' : '');
}
?>
</div>

<a class="link" href="top.php"><img src="/style/icons/st1.png"> Участники <span class="c"><?= mysql_result(mysql_query("SELECT COUNT(*) FROM `roller`  WHERE `days` > '1' "),0)?></span></a>

<?
include_once H.'sys/inc/tfoot.php';
?>